Vape waste creates three huge environmental issues:

  • Increase in single-use plastics
  • Increase in tech waste from their parts, including lithium-ion batteries
  • Introduction of hazardous and toxic chemicals like nicotine into the environment when discarded

If thrown in the trash or flushed into the sewer system, the nicotine solution in an e-liquid product can seep into the ground or water and become a danger for wildlife and humans.Sep 23, 2020

What happens to vape batteries when you throw them out?

However, when vape batteries are tossed in the trash, they reach landfills where they release harmful metals such as mercury, lead, and cadmium into the surrounding soil causing contamination, ultimately putting those malignant materials into your water supply.

How to dispose of vapes and e-cigarettes?

If you have a broken or a leaking battery, the best way to dispose them of is to look for companies or stores that recycle these batteries. Many companies and websites like accept back their used vapes and e-cigarettes and they also have a mailing facility available.

What happens if you throw your e-liquid in the trash?

If thrown in the trash or flushed into the sewer system, the nicotine solution in an e-liquid product can seep into the ground or water and become a danger for wildlife and humans. 3, 7, 8 As e-cigarette batteries degrade, the compounds in them can also seep into nearby water.

Can my vape explode?

Although these incidents appear uncommon, vape fires and explosions are dangerous to the person using the vaping product and others around them. There may be added dangers, for example, if a vape battery catches fire or explodes near flammable gasses or liquids, such as oxygen, propane, or gasoline.

Can you throw away a disposable vape?

Single use, non-rechargeable or “disposable” These devices contain lithium batteries that are a fire hazard when placed in the garbage or a recycling bin. Do not place these items in your garbage. Contact your county Solid Waste or Household Hazardous waste program for information on proper disposal.

Can You Throw Away Vape Batteries?

It is crucial that you DO NOT THROW YOUR VAPE BATTERY IN THE TRASH! — Lithium-ion batteries are harmful to the environment. Be mindful that these batteries are prone to explode or leak harmful chemicals that can start fires.

What is the Proper Way to Dispose of Batteries?

Disposing of an undamaged e-cig battery is as easy as tracking down your local battery store. Many establishments (Batteries + comes to mind) will make use of your used and unwanted batteries for free or for a low fee, keeping them out of landfills and helping reduce their impact on the environment.

How Do I know if My 18650 Battery is Bad?

A standard 18650 battery lasts about 300 cycles (a cycle is when your rechargeable battery goes from completely full to completely empty). The tell-tale signs that it’s time to retire your vape are basically the same as you’d expect from your phone: when your phone quits charging or dies at 69% constantly, it means its battery has been compromised.

When Should I Throw Out My 18650 Battery?

How quickly your battery will be expended is dependent on how often you use it. If you vape a lot, say two full cycles a day, your vaporizer should be good for about six months with proper care.

What vapes are discarded?

SINGLE-USE, DISPOSABLE VAPES like Puff Bar, Mylé, Stig, Vuse, and Mojo pose the biggest threat. They are used only once and then discarded with their LITHIUM-ION BATTERY, plastic, and metal parts. From 2019 to 2020, DISPOSABLE VAPE USE WENT UP 1000% among high schoolers who vape. A growing mound of toxic trash.

How much e-waste is discarded every year?

99 billion pounds of e-waste are discarded every year. A recent study found nearly 20% of litter at CA high schools came from e-cigarettes. The popularity of vapes is driven by GIANT CIGARETTE COMPANIES like Philip Morris and RJ Reynolds.

Is vaping bad for the environment?

Vapes are horrible for the environment. Liquid nicotine is recognized by the EPA as HAZARDOUS WASTE. With that and other residual substances, e-cigarette litter can pose a biohazard risk to the environment. Vapes typically contain BATTERIES, METAL COILS, PLASTICS, and HARMFUL CHEMICALS.
